Common Causes of Sage Monthly Payment Errors
Several factors can prevent your Sage subscription payment from processing successfully.
Common causes include:
- Expired credit or debit card
- Incorrect billing information
- Insufficient account balance
- Bank declining the transaction
- Expired subscription details
- Internet connectivity issues
- Temporary Sage payment server issues
- Browser cache or cookie problems
- Payment authorization failure
- Account verification issues

How to Fix Sage Monthly Program Payment Errors
Verify Payment Method
Confirm that your credit or debit card is active and has not expired.
Check Billing Information
Ensure your billing address, postal code, and payment details are correct.
Confirm Available Funds
Verify that your bank account or card has sufficient funds.
Contact Your Bank
Ask whether the transaction was blocked for security or authorization reasons.
Use a Different Payment Method
Try another valid payment card if the current one continues to fail.
Clear Browser Cache
Remove cached files and cookies before attempting payment again.
Check Internet Connection
Ensure you have a stable internet connection during the payment process.
Retry the Payment Later
If the issue is caused by temporary server maintenance, try again after some time.
